Isaiah 33

Darby's Synopsis of the New TestamentDarby's Synopsis

Introduction

1:1 (d-0) (The title of this book, 'Isaiah'), Meaning, 'Salvation of Jah.' see Psalms 68:4 .

Verse 4

33:4 caterpillar. (b-12) Lit. 'the devourer.' see Psalms 78:46 ; Joel 1:4 .

Verse 6

33:6 knowledge. (c-16) Or 'wisdom and knowledge shall be the stability of thy times, the riches of salvation.' your (d-23) Lit. 'his,' i.e. Israel's.

Verse 9

33:9 Sharon (e-12) See Note, 1 Chronicles 27:29 desert, (f-17) The Arabah . see Note b, Joshua 3:16 .

Verse 11

33:11 breath (g-12) Or 'anger.'

Verse 14

33:14 hypocrites. (h-11) Or 'impious,' as ch. 9.17.

Verse 15

33:15 shutteth (i-34) As ch. 29.10.

Verse 21

33:21 of (a-11) or 'the mighty Jehovah will there be for us a place of.'
